Oxblood red patent leather Stella slippers
$543Size
Patent Leather Stella Slipper with buckles, a cushioned calf leather insole and leather piping.
8mm heel.
Made in Italy.
Patent Leather Stella Slipper with buckles, a cushioned calf leather insole and leather piping.
8mm heel.
Made in Italy.